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 12 Weeks
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 484-BGA
Number of Pins 484
Supplier Device Package 484-FPBGA (23x23)
Weight 400.011771mg
Operating Temperature0°C~85°C TJ
PackagingTray
Published 2009
Series ProASIC3L
Part StatusActive
Moisture Sensitivity Level (MSL) 3 (168 Hours)
Max Operating Temperature70°C
Min Operating Temperature 0°C
Voltage - Supply 1.14V~1.575V
Base Part Number A3P600L
Operating Supply Voltage1.2V
Max Supply Voltage1.26V
Min Supply Voltage1.14V
Operating Supply Current 5mA
Number of I/O 235
RAM Size 13.5kB
Total RAM Bits 110592
Number of Gates600000
Max Frequency 781.25MHz
Number of Registers 13824
Height 1.73mm
Length 23mm
Width 23mm
Radiation HardeningNo
RoHS StatusNon-RoHS Compliant
